Job Summary :
The Ski & Snowboard Team Jr Devo Far West Segment Head Coachoversees a specific age class, segment or sub-segment of a ski or snowboarddiscipline within Team Palisades Tahoe. The Segment Head Coach contributes tothe overall success of Team Palisades Tahoe in accordance with the Mission andVision as measured by the quality of the athlete and employee experience,retention, athlete success, and parent satisfaction. This position worksdirectly with a department or Age Class Manager. Applicants must be 18 years of age. The base hourly pay range below represents the low and high end of thePalisades Tahoe Resort, LLCs hourly pay range for this position. Actual paywill vary and may be above or below the range based on various factorsincluding but not limited to experience, education, training, location, meritsystem, quantity or quality of production, responsibilities, and regularandor necessary travel. The range listed is just one component of PalisadesTahoe Resort, LLCs total compensation package for employees. Other rewardsmay include short-term and long-term incentives and many region-specificbenefits. Base hourly pay range : $22.60 - $39.10 per hour
Essential Job ResponsibilitiesDutiesTasks
include the following; otherduties may be assigned :
Responsible for successful oversight and implementation of specific segment or sub-segment (genderageabilityetc.) of a department discipline andor age class.
Contribute and conform to team athletic processes and philosophies. Work with Manager and other Head Coaches to develop annual training plan. Pursues and maintains coaching certifications while engaging in continuous professional development.
Ensure individual athlete management programs are in place and overseen.
Be knowledgeable and stay informed on industry trends and competition and seek feedback from athletes, parents, staff and company personnel on quality of products and services.
Be fully aware of and support the mission, vision and goals of all aspects of our program, including Alterra.
Knowledge and execution of Department Operating Plan and Guest Experience System
Maintain a regular on-hill presence with direct involvement with daily programming and plans, working directly with Manager.
Participate in all staff training and meetings as required Assist in the management of, and hold coaches (and self) accountable to :
Time & Attendance Standards
Team and company missionvisionvalues and policies
Performance managementperformance reviews
Team expectations for athletic advancement
Use of company approved tools
Participation in all required meetings and trainings

Physical Requirements :
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must bemet by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of thisjob.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als withdisabilities to perform the essential functions.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required towalk, talk, see, and hear. Must be capable of walking or standing 90% or moreof a normal work shift. Must be capable of occasionally carrying, lifting,pushing or pulling up to 75lbs. Must be capable of occasionally squatting,bending, kneeling, reaching, and balancing, able to climb ladders and shovelsnow.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ision,distance vision, peripheral vision, depth perceptions and the ability toadjust focus.
Working Conditions :
IndoorOutdoor :
While performing the duties of this job, the employee willfrequently be exposed to outside weather conditions. The employee willfrequently be exposed to extreme cold, wetness andor humidity, andoccasionally blizzards and extreme storm conditions.
Hazardous MaterialsNoise :
The noise level in the workplace is usuallymoderate.

Education and Experience :
Required :
High School Diploma or GED
Fluent in reading, writing and communicating in English
USSA Level 100, PSIAAASI Level 1, IFSA or equivalent
Prior coaching experience
Prior experience working with youth Preferred
Supervisory Experience
Level 2200 or higher relevant skiing certification
Efficient knowledge of Microsoft Office
